This patch set adds,

1. Jumbo frame support
2. Pause frame based flow control

and fixes RSS for non-TCP/UDP packets.

* [PATCH net-next 0/8] drivers: net: xgene: Add Jumbo and Pause frame support
  2016-12-02  0:41 [PATCH net-next 0/8] drivers: net: xgene: Add Jumbo and Pause frame support Iyappan Subramanian
                   ` (7 preceding siblings ...)
  2016-12-02  0:41 ` [PATCH net-next 8/8] drivers: net: xgene: ethtool: Add get/set_pauseparam Iyappan Subramanian
@ 2016-12-03 20:47 ` David Miller
  8 siblings, 0 replies; 10+ messages in thread
From: David Miller @ 2016-12-03 20:47 UTC (permalink / raw)
  To: linux-arm-kernel

From: Iyappan Subramanian <isubramanian@apm.com>
Date: Thu,  1 Dec 2016 16:41:36 -0800

> This patch set adds,
> 
> 1. Jumbo frame support
> 2. Pause frame based flow control
> 
> and fixes RSS for non-TCP/UDP packets.
> 
> Signed-off-by: Iyappan Subramanian <isubramanian@apm.com>

Series applied, thanks.
